Horrible prediction regarding the oil spill disaster

Via the Hill Buzz guys, who are worried the spill is much worse than we realize, comes a pessimistic insider's look at the prospects of actually stopping the oil from gushing into the Gulf, which will be changed forever in our lifetimes:
What is likely to happen now? 
Well...none of what is likely to happen is good, in fact...it's about as bad as it gets. I am convinced the erosion and compromising of the entire system is accelerating and attacking more key structural areas of the well, the blow out preventer and surrounding strata holding it all up and together. This is evidenced by the tilt of the blow out preventer and the erosion which has exposed the well head connection. What eventually will happen is that the blow out preventer will literally tip over if they do not run supports to it as the currents push on it. I suspect they will run those supports as cables tied to anchors very soon, if they don't, they are inviting disaster that much sooner.
